I'm very much with the people upthread who said to just say "No thank you!" <smile!>. If they want to know why, just say "Looks great, but I don't want any right now!" <smile!>. If they start saying things about worry about your health and "don't lose too much now!" and so on, just say "I'll be sure to ask my doctor about it and if he agrees, I'll follow his advice!". Just stick to your guns. Don't get into arguments and discussions with them about weight loss! They're not going to come around to your view point, so just skip it. Here are your weapons: "No thank you!" "Thanks, but I'm not hungry right now!" "I just ate before I came." "Couldn't eat another bite" "I just finished some!" "I'm meeting a friend for lunch in an hour" "I'll take a little with me" (then pitch it in the trash as soon as you leave).
